The Goethe Certificate Many universities in Germany and other countries accept the Goethe certificate. The preparation for the exam takes effort and time. There are six different levels ranging from A1 to C2. Some exams are open to children, while others are only available for adults. The Goethe certificates evaluate four skills in the field of language that include listening comprehension, reading comprehension, written expression, and oral expression. While the OSD and Goethe German certificates are similar but they differ in usability, administration, and language competence. The OSD is administered by the Austrian Ministry of Education focuses on academic German, while the Goethe Zertifikat was designed by the Goethe Institute to emphasize practical, everyday language skills. Paper-based format The Goethe exam is a recognized international diploma that attests to an exact level of German language proficiency. It is a part of the Common European Framework of Reference for Languages, so it can be used in many universities and by employers. The Goethe test is a great way to enhance your foreign language proficiency and enhance your job prospects. The test is split into four parts that include writing, reading and speaking. The exams are administered using a paper-based format and you'll need to pass each part. The writing section requires you to write a 250-word essay on a topic you have chosen. You will also write two informal “forum postings” and one formal email. Writing in German is a different skill than writing in your native language. In addition, you must learn to organize your arguments in a formal manner, and use appropriate language and tone. Digital format The Goethe Certificate is a highly regarded German language exam that determines your proficiency in German over six levels, ranging from beginner to advanced. The exam is aligned to the Common European Framework of Reference for Languages or CEFR. It is also recognized internationally. The exam is comprised of four papers or sections that include reading, listening writing, speaking, and listening. Each level is designed for different abilities. The A1 and A2 levels assess basic communication skills, whereas B1-B2 levels test more complex language understanding.
